#81530a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#81530a is composed of 50.6% red, 32.5%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.7% magenta, 92.2%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 36.8 degrees, a saturation of 85.6% and a lightness of 27.3%. #81530a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a614 with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#81530a color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].

#81530a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#81530a has RGB values of R:129, G:83,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.92,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8475402.

Shades and Tints of #81530a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fef8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#81530a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464645 is the less saturated color, while #865405 is the most saturated one.
